    There are a few places in any truck stop where you are the most likely to get hit by another truck. The end of an isle is at the top of the list, and I never have and never will park there. I usually get paid parking, and only then if there are wide open spaces in front of the spot where I know that other trucks won't be double parking in the middle of the night.
